Professionals in these internships typically engage in a multifaceted set of responsibilities central to account management and client success. Common duties include serving as a primary point of contact for client inquiries, coordinating project timelines, and facilitating communication between internal teams (like research, product, or strategy) and external stakeholders. A significant part of the role often involves logistical coordination, such as scheduling meetings, preparing client reports and presentations, and meticulously tracking project milestones. Interns also frequently assist in gathering client feedback, conducting basic market or client research, and ensuring that deliverables meet both quality standards and deadlines. The essence of the position is ownership and organization, managing multiple parallel workstreams in a fast-paced, deadline-driven environment. To excel in Client Service Intern jobs, candidates generally need a specific blend of soft skills and foundational knowledge. Exceptional communication and interpersonal skills are paramount, as the role requires constant interaction via phone, email, and virtual meetings. Strong organizational abilities and acute attention to detail are critical for managing complex schedules and project details. Employers typically seek self-starters with a proactive mindset, commercial awareness, and the capacity to learn quickly about the company's industry and services. Common requirements include current enrollment in a Bachelor’s or Master’s degree program (often in Business, Economics, Communications, or related fields), a demonstrated record of academic and extracurricular achievement, and proficiency in relevant business software. Fluency in English is a standard expectation, with additional language skills being a valuable asset in global firms.
